»Datscha – Eine russische Überlebensstrategie« – Osteuropa-Gesprächsabend

In the organizer's words:

Book presentation and open discussion with the Polish cultural anthropologist Dr. Irena Mostowicz. In "Datscha. A Russian Survival Strategy", she sheds light on summer houses as living space and a means of self-sufficiency - and critically places the 200-year-old dacha tradition in the context of the Russian war of aggression against Ukraine.

Free admission - registration not required

Organized by the Debating Club of former Eastern European students of the FU.
